Work to begin on Park Center Well

The following press releases was published by the U.S. Department of the Interior, Bureau of Land Management on July 6, 2015. It is reproduced in full below.

CANON CITY, Colo. - The Bureau of Land Management Royal Gorge Field Office is set to begin work on the Park Center Well this week. Construction on the site will require the use of a short bypass road on Red Canyon Road. Work on the well is expected to take less than two weeks.

Park Center Well is an 80-year-old artesian well located on BLM-administered public lands near Cañon City. The well supplies domestic and fire suppression uses to approximately 4,000 users in the Park Center Water District.
